Thermal Management

It is important to control heat in lights. Good thermal management keeps LEDs from getting too hot. This helps them stay bright. Manufacturers use different ways to cool the lights.

Aluminum spreads heat out so it does not build up.

Parts are placed to let air move and cool the fixture.

High-quality LEDs work well for a long time.

There are two main ways to cool the lights:

Active cooling uses fans or vents for more airflow.

Passive cooling uses heat sinks and pads to move heat away.

Aluminum heat sinks have fins or grooves. These make more surface area. Air can move around the fixture better. This helps in hot places like factories.

Heat Sink

Heat sinks keep your lights cool and working longer. Extruded aluminum heat sinks have fins for more cooling. Stamped aluminum heat sinks work for small lights. Heat pipes move heat fast in strong lights. Some lights use fans for extra cooling. Heat moves from the LED to the heat sink, then air takes it away.

Extruded aluminum heat sinks are good and save money.

Stamped aluminum heat sinks work for simple lights.

Heat pipes move heat fast in big lights.

Fans help cool lights in hot places.

Fins make more space for heat to leave.

Heat Sink Type

Application

Performance Level

Extruded Aluminum

General industrial use

High

Stamped Aluminum

Low-power applications

Moderate

Heat Pipes

High-power environments

Very High

Active Cooling Fans

Extreme heat situations

Maximum

Factories

Factories need good lighting to keep work safe. LED Batten Lights are bright and show colors well. They spread light evenly across the room. The table below shows what factories need for lighting:

Lighting Requirement

Specification

Illuminance Levels (Lux)

150–2,000 (varies by task)

Uniformity Ratio

0.6 or more

Color Rendering Index (CRI)

80+

Glare Control

Anti-glare features

Efficiency

Energy-efficient systems

LED Batten Lights use less energy than old lights. You can save up to 75% on power. These lights last up to 50,000 hours. You do not need to fix them often. They are bright and make work safer for everyone.

Benefits Over Traditional Lighting

LED Batten Lights are better than old bulbs. They use 80–90% less energy than incandescent bulbs. You only need 13 watts for 800 lumens. Old bulbs need 60 watts for the same light. You can save 30–90% energy in factories. These lights last 50,000–80,000 hours. You do not need to change them often.

Lighting Type

Energy Use (for 800 lm)

Lifespan (hours)

Maintenance Needs

LED Batten Lights

13W

50,000–80,000

Low

Incandescent Bulbs

60W

1,000

High

Fluorescent Tubes

18–36W

10,000–15,000

Moderate
